RE: Crock Pot Recipe for Beef Roast

I use boneless chuck roast with as much fat trimmed off as possible. Season with S & P, seasoned salt & ground garlic. Sear in skillet on med high heat until both sides are brown. Place carrots and potatoes, peeled & cut up in the bottom of crockpot. Add browned roast on top. After removing roast from skillet, add some cold water to remove brown stuff from skillet and pour over roast. I also usually add an additional 1/4 - 1/2 cup more water to it too in addition to what I put in the skillet. Top with one large cut up onion (or more to taste). I also salt & pepper potatoes & carrots after putting them in pot. Cook 4 hours on high, or longer on low. I really don't know how long to cook it on low as I usually cook this on Sunday mornings for lunch while where at church. The house smells wonderful when we come in the door!

RE: Acer Laptop from WM

Depending on Network configuration, you could have to enter a password to connect. At the bottom of your screen, you should see a signal meter. This is your Wi Fi signal. The higher the bars, the better the signal. If you right click that icon, you will see a popup that says connections. Chose the network you want to join from the list and click connect. If you need a password, it will prompt you to enter a password. Then click connect. It will also give you the option to save that configuration so you don't have to type in the password every time.
